282
283 /*
284  * Save a copy of the parent list, and return the saved copy.  This is
285  * used by the log machinery to retrieve the original parents when
286  * commit->parents has been modified by history simpification.
287  *
288  * You may only call save_parents() once per commit (this is checked
289  * for non-root commits).
290  *
291  * get_saved_parents() will transparently return commit->parents if
292  * history simplification is off.
293  */
294 extern void save_parents(struct rev_info *revs, struct commit *commit);
295 extern struct commit_list *get_saved_parents(struct rev_info *revs, const struct commit *commit);
296 extern void free_saved_parents(struct rev_info *revs);
